I did a search on this but nothing really came back. One of the things that can be a bit of a niggle when you take the 8P on a road trip is the lack of 2 cup holders. So I was wondering if any one had ever found an easy way to add an aditional one to the car? Or would the most practical way be to just get one of those cheap and cheerful stick on ones?  :lol:

Seb.

You could retrofit one in the blank space to the right of the hazard warning light switch item 20.

Both Jay & myself have retrofitted the card hold tray as on other models.
Attached File  20190218_151956.jpg   66.17K   25 downloads

Be warned the reason the cup hold is not fitted on models with Satnav is due to accidental spillage into the head unit.

Dell.
